蜘蛛池搭建与tt氵云速捷,探索高效网络爬虫策略,蜘蛛池平台

博主:adminadmin 今天 2
蜘蛛池平台是一种高效的网络爬虫策略,通过搭建蜘蛛池,可以实现对多个网站或网页的并发抓取,提高抓取效率和准确性,结合tt氵云速捷等云服务,可以实现更快速、更稳定的网络爬虫服务,该平台支持自定义爬虫规则、支持多种数据存储方式,并提供丰富的API接口,方便用户进行二次开发和扩展,通过优化爬虫策略,可以实现对目标网站的高效抓取,提高数据获取的速度和质量。
  1. 蜘蛛池基本概念与优势
  2. tt氵云速捷技术简介
  3. 蜘蛛池搭建步骤与策略
  4. 优化与运维策略
  5. 案例分析与未来展望

在数字化时代,网络爬虫技术已成为数据收集、分析与挖掘的重要工具,而“蜘蛛池”作为一种高效的爬虫管理系统,通过整合多个爬虫资源,实现了对目标网站信息的快速抓取与高效管理,本文将深入探讨蜘蛛池搭建的核心理念,并结合tt氵云速捷技术,解析如何构建并优化一个高效、稳定的蜘蛛池系统,以应对复杂多变的网络环境。

蜘蛛池基本概念与优势

1 蜘蛛池定义

蜘蛛池,顾名思义,是一个集中管理和调度多个网络爬虫(即“蜘蛛”)的平台,它类似于一个“爬虫农场”,每个爬虫负责特定的数据抓取任务,通过统一的接口进行任务分配、状态监控及结果收集,极大地提高了数据收集的效率与灵活性。

2 优势分析

  • 资源复用:多个爬虫共享同一套基础设施,减少重复建设成本。
  • 任务分配:根据爬虫性能及网络状况动态分配任务,优化资源利用。
  • 故障恢复:自动检测并替换故障爬虫,保证系统稳定性。
  • 数据分析:集中处理抓取数据,便于后续分析与挖掘。

tt氵云速捷技术简介

1 技术背景

tt氵云速捷是一种基于云计算的加速解决方案,旨在通过优化数据传输路径、提升服务器处理能力等手段,实现网络访问速度的大幅提升,对于蜘蛛池而言,这意味着能够更快地完成网页加载与数据解析,从而显著提高爬虫效率。

2 技术特点

  • 动态路由:根据网络状况智能选择最优路径,减少延迟。
  • 缓存加速:对频繁访问的资源进行缓存,减少服务器负担。
  • 负载均衡:合理分配网络资源,避免单点过载。
  • 安全加密:保障数据传输安全,防止数据泄露。

蜘蛛池搭建步骤与策略

1 前期准备

  • 需求分析:明确爬虫目标、数据类型及预期输出。
  • 环境搭建:选择适合的服务器(考虑性能、成本、可扩展性),安装必要的软件(如Python、Scrapy等)。
  • 技术选型:根据需求选择合适的框架和工具,如Django用于构建后端管理界面,Redis用于任务队列和状态存储。

2 架构设计

  • 分布式架构:采用微服务架构,将爬虫管理、任务分配、数据存储等功能模块化,便于扩展与维护。
  • 消息队列:使用RabbitMQ或Kafka等消息中间件,实现任务分发与结果收集的无缝对接。
  • 数据库设计:设计合理的数据库模型,用于存储爬虫配置、任务状态、抓取结果等。

3 爬虫开发与集成

  • 编写爬虫脚本:根据目标网站特点编写Scrapy或Selenium等爬虫脚本,实现数据抓取功能。
  • 接口对接:开发API接口,使爬虫能够接入蜘蛛池系统,接收任务指令并上报抓取结果。
  • 异常处理:在爬虫中集成异常处理机制,确保遇到问题时能自动重试或记录错误日志。

4 tt氵云速捷集成与应用

  • 配置加速服务:在蜘蛛池系统中集成tt氵云速捷服务,通过API调用实现网络加速。
  • 性能监控:定期监测爬虫执行速度及成功率,根据反馈调整加速策略。
  • 成本优化:根据实际需求调整加速服务级别,平衡成本与性能。

优化与运维策略

1 性能优化

  • 并行处理:通过多线程或多进程实现并发抓取,提高单位时间内的数据获取量。
  • 缓存策略:对静态资源实施缓存策略,减少重复请求。
  • 负载均衡:动态调整爬虫数量与任务分配,避免资源闲置或过载。

2 安全与合规

  • 反爬策略:实施合理的反爬机制,避免被目标网站封禁IP。
  • 隐私保护:确保抓取的数据符合隐私保护法规要求,不泄露用户信息。
  • 合规性检查:定期检查爬虫行为是否符合目标网站的使用条款及法律法规。

3 运维管理

  • 自动化运维:利用Docker、Kubernetes等容器化技术实现自动化部署与扩展。
  • 监控报警:建立全面的监控系统,对系统状态、性能指标进行实时监控并设置报警阈值。
  • 备份恢复:定期备份系统配置与数据,确保数据安全与可恢复性。

案例分析与未来展望

1 案例分享

以某电商平台为例,通过搭建蜘蛛池系统并结合tt氵云速捷技术,成功实现了每日数百万条商品信息的快速抓取与更新,大幅提升了数据更新频率与准确性,为后续的数据分析与决策支持提供了坚实的基础。

2 未来趋势

随着大数据与人工智能技术的不断发展,未来的蜘蛛池系统将更加智能化、自动化,通过机器学习算法自动调整爬虫策略以应对网站结构变化;利用AI技术从海量数据中提取有价值的信息;以及通过区块链技术保障数据的安全性与可信度等,这些技术的发展将进一步推动网络爬虫技术在各个领域的应用与创新。

蜘蛛池搭建与tt氵云速捷技术的结合,为高效、稳定的数据抓取提供了强有力的支持,通过合理的架构设计、高效的性能优化以及严格的安全合规措施,我们可以构建出适应复杂网络环境的高效爬虫系统,随着技术的不断进步与创新应用场景的拓展,网络爬虫技术将在更多领域发挥重要作用并推动行业变革与发展。

The End

发布于:2025-06-07,除非注明,否则均为7301.cn - SEO技术交流社区原创文章,转载请注明出处。